  • I recently had the chance to work with a friend who was temping up Wind Ensemble music with the VSL Saxophones I, and frankly he buried them in the mix, because the attacks and vibrato are too much too blend with the ensemble. The soprano does okay, but the tenor has extreme timbral changes with the slightest increase in velocity and it just didn't blend with the ensemble. And who needs a soprano before bari and alto? He ended up using samples of me playing instead.

    I love the Opus 2 samples I just purchased, and I have high hopes that Saxophones II will provide a more useful sampling of the alto and bari. That being said, I think that the VSL saxes were the best sax library when released...they just don't work for what wind ensemble and band people need.
